Nederlands: Dr. F. Schmidt Degener, hoofddirecteur van het Rijksmuseum, van wien het initiatief tot deze expositie uitging, leidt de pers rond bij het eerste bezoek aan „Onze Kunst van Heden”. De bezoekers bevinden zich hier in de zaal, waar vroeger de oude Italiaanse kunst hing.
